Tin Aung San

[5] Tin Aung San was promoted as Commander-in-Chief of the Myanmar Navy in August 2015, succeeding Admiral Thura Thet Swe, who retired to run for political office.

[6][7][8] After the 2021 Myanmar coup d'état, Tin Aung San was appointed a member of the State Administration Council (SAC) on 2 February 2021.

[9][10] He subsequently relinquished his position as the Commander-in-Chief of the Myanmar Navy, with Admiral Moe Aung assuming the role.

[14] The Government of Canada has imposed sanctions on Tin Aung San since 18 February 2021, pursuant to Special Economic Measures Act and Special Economic Measures (Burma) Regulations, in response to the gravity of the human rights and humanitarian situation in Myanmar (formerly Burma).
